Almas são materiais de criação do Modo Difícil derrubados por inimigos. Há um total de 6 almas Versão para 3DS); as mais comuns são as Almas da Luz e da Noite, e esses dois tipos de almas são derrubados no Subterrâneo Consagrado e no Subterrâneo dos biomas maléficos respectivamente. A maioria das almas restantes são derrubadas pelos chefes mecânicos.

Notes

  • For the Souls of Light and Night, note that only the biome (cavern layer Underground Corruption/Crimson or Hallow) determines what soul will be dropped, not the enemy. For instance, an Illuminant Bat in the Corruption will drop Souls of Night, and a Corruptor in the Hallow will drop Souls of Light. All enemies, including enemies that already spawned during Pre-Hardmode can drop Souls of Night or Souls of Light if in the appropriate biome. The only exceptions are enemies spawned by a statue and the King Slime's minions.
  • Unlike most other enemy drops, souls are not affected by gravity (Versão para 3DS except the Souls of Blight), and thus remain floating in midair at the location where the enemy was killed. For large enemies and bosses, this is usually the enemy's head, regardless of where the final strike occurred.

Tips

  • An easy way to obtain Souls of Night and Light is to go to the Dungeon and spray Red/Purple/Blue Solution with the Clentaminator at different areas, converting the area into the respective evil biome. Because of the Dungeon's high spawn rate, it is possible to get a large amount of souls fairly quickly.
  • Another very effective way to farm Souls of Night and Light is to craft a Slime Crown and summon the King Slime in the appropriate underground biome. Each fight often yields over 20 souls from all of the slimes that are spawned.
